- If you run a website that collects or distributes personally identifiable information, you'll want to make sure that you have a strong online privacy notice available to your users. Privacy notices are clear statements that inform users of your organization's privacy practices. Some of the common elements of privacy notices include disclosing the types of information that you collect and the purposes of your data collection, describing how and when you collect personal information, detailing any ways that you share information with third parties, disclosing the ways that you safeguard PII, informing users of your opt-in and opt-out procedures, and providing contact information for follow-up if the user has questions about the policy or wants to report a known or suspected privacy issue.
